Output 516222bc391f1e1dacde6f4214c3a88f389403be97a2f45746559b49cb2ff30d:4

value
3089659
script pubkey
OP_0 OP_PUSHBYTES_32 d9f3c6a010a1cd039b2a2d98a9507d8ed66a81ab05040ecf6846dd7d1a1dfbac
address
bc1qm8eudgqs58xs8xe29kv2j5ra3mtx4qdtq5zqanmggmwh6xsalwkq9e0xxq
transaction
516222bc391f1e1dacde6f4214c3a88f389403be97a2f45746559b49cb2ff30d
spent
true